I had the opportunity to view this kit in person here in Michigan long before the infamouis p00der2 purchased it and then offered it on e-Bay for what seems like FOREVER.

I could have bought it for $500 with a Rogers Dyna-Sonic snare but decided against it. There were simply too many "issues" with it, both cosmetically and functionally. :(

The Ploughman is correct (as usual) in that the shells didn't originally come in that "natural" finish. There was DEFINITELY some sort of wrap originally on the shells which was stripped off. The shells were than stained. Whoever did the staining did a horrific job. Certain areas of the shells look much darker than others and the application was extremely uneven with stain actually running down the shells in different areas. In addition to that, there are different shades of stain on the three drums -- They don't match at all when viewed in person.

The interior shells were also painted black and were in very rough condition and the bearing edges were in terrible shape. As you can see in the pics, the asking price doesn't include one of the wooden hoops or head for the bass drum and the bottom rim and head for the floor tom.

As also stated by The Ploughman, the bass drum center mount was not original to this kit and is for a double rack tom while only one rack tom is included in this sale.

When I viewed the kit, the swiv-o-matic "arms" for the double rack toms were present. p00der2 must have either sold them separately or simply removed them from the mount.
